Unlock abilities that have always been, or that are now becoming increasingly difficult to perform by learning deeper about...
 
KAMAE
  Your state of mind reflected into your body to generate a cohesive posture of psychological and structural strength that is not solely dependent upon external positioning.
 
AIKI
A subtle kamae manipulation skill, executed through the control of coordinated muscle tone. Utilising physics and bio-mechanics in your favour, this primary principle initiates kuzushi to allow efficacy in techniques.
 
KUZUSHI
The principal of creating instability/weakening of an opponent’s
Equilibrium
Structural integrity
Psychological focus.
KOKYU
This core principle is more than just life support. Breathing cohesively through your kamae enhances Aiki, kuzushi, power generation, techniques and initial physical movement.
 
TAI SABAKI
The principle is not using your legs to move your body, but using your whole body to move yourself into tactically advantageous positions and flow effectively through techniques.
 
KIAI
This is principal is more than a loud noise to focus yourself and causes distraction. Kiai also explosively releases directed vibrational power from a chain reaction of Aiki, kokyu, hara, core joints & limbs. Kiai greatly amplifies kuzushi and Jutsu principals, also allows incredibly fast Taisobaki.
 
JUTSU
Distilled martial art principals that are not hindered by style or rules, Subdivided into these groups…
 
KANSETSU / Joint Manipulations
SHIME / Flesh Constrictions
KYUSHO / Vital points
NAGE / Throws
ATEMI / Strikes
BUKI / Weapons 
 
Combined to affect body systems...
 
MUSCULAR SKELETAL
CARDIOVASCULAR
RESPIRATORY
NERVOUS
ORGAN
 
Learn how to seamlessly incorporate these de-stylised principles into your art. Hosie Sensei believes that all the martial arts like Karate, Judo, Win Chun, Aikido, Tai Chi, Jujitsu and Ba Gua for example... All originally had the same core principles, it is only their expression that separated them.
